Two area students elected to Phi Kappa Phi honor society

Two area students elected to Phi Kappa Phi honor society

The following locals recently were elected to membership into the Honor Society of Phi Kappa Phi, the nation’s oldest and most selective collegiate honor society for all academic disciplines:
- Madeline Clements of Sherman at Florida International University
- Stefanie Martin of Van Alstyne at Oklahoma State University

They are among approximately 20,000 students, faculty, professional staff and alumni to be initiated into Phi Kappa Phi each year. 

Membership is by invitation only and requires nomination and approval by a chapter. Only the top 10 percent of seniors and 7.5 percent of juniors are eligible for membership.
